Barcelona superstar Lionel Messi has emerged at the top of Sky Sports La Liga Power Rankings. And this is not his first time. He has achieved this honour for the fifth time. The second place is acquired by Messi’s teammate, Luis Suarez, who has also managed to retain his spot as the runner-up on the list, after he netted an equaliser for his team against Alaves in their recent match, before Messi helped to seal a 2-1 win with a stunning free-kick. and now Messi Leads Sky Sports La Liga Power Rankings.

Real Madrid succeeded in beating Valencia and reduced the pressure on their coach Zinedine Zidane, and Cristiano Ronaldo netted the ball twice, before the team reached a 4-1 score, thanks to Toni Kroos and Marcelo who helped secure the win. CR7, Gareth Bale and Marcelo acquired the 6th, 7th and 8th places, respectively, while Kroos went up to the 4th place.

Iago Aspas, the striker of Celta Vigo had two goals in his team’s 3-2 win against Real Betis, and is in the 3rd place. Antoine Griezmann, the forward of Atletico Madrid, reached the 10th place, after he opened the scoring for his team in a 3-0 victory over Las Palmas. Villarreal’s midfielders Samu Castillejo and Pablo Fornals helped with a 4-2 win against Real Sociedad. While Fornals got ranked 5th, Castillejo earned the ninth.

The methodology of Power Rankings is a reflection of the performances of players during the last five games, as points are awarded to the players based on 32 different stats. Messi’s chart-topping rank has been supported by 15,427 points, while Ronaldo, with 7,300 points, is 6 places behind him.

The ranks are obviously updated in every week throughout the whole season, to showcase the movements of the players’ on the list. Except for a drop by Bale, and Messi and Suarez staying static, all the other players have had an improvement in their ranks.
